Control reference guide

Recorder front panel
REC button ( )
Starts recording of video and sound
to a P2 card.
STOP button ( )
Stops recording.
P2 card slots 1, 2
Insert P2 cards here.
Up to two cards can be inserted
simultaneously.
(2 GB, 4 GB, 8 GB cards only)
EJECT button
Serves to eject a P2 card.
REC LED
Lights up during recording. If the
combined remaining recording time
for the cards inserted in the P2 card
slots 1 and 2 is less than 30
minutes (see page 23), the LED
starts to flash.
10
READY LED
Lights up when recording is
possible on a P2 card inserted in a
P2 card slot (see page 23).
BUSY LED
Lights up or flashes while a P2 card
is accessed (recording or playback;
see page 23).
Lock
Serves to lock and unlock the cover
of the P2 card slots.
Cover
Protects the P2 card slots.
